Specsavers in Billericay is seeking a qualified Optometrist for a part-time role, working 2-4 days a week. You'll join a supportive team with extensive experience, focusing on customer care and professional excellence.
This position offers competitive pay, a team bonus, and numerous benefits including private health cover, pension contributions, and annual leave.
Ideal candidates are GOC registered and passionate about community engagement. Contact Katie Francome for more details.
